    The greatest unknown is what bucket the remediation work is being attributed to - i.e. are these one off costs being lumped in the production cost category? I think we'll need a couple of quarters of consistent production to get a feel for costs - not only the remediation cost component, but also to work out the fixed versus variable costs. For instance, we don't know whether we are paying a certain static fee or effectively a tolling price per gj. My gut feel is that there is a solid static component that will see the overall per gj cost reduce significantly as we scale up. The complicating factor is then the cost of rental equipment for Odin. A lot of variables and I suspect we won't be getting clear answers in this quarterly.
